hi folks i'm running a berhinger vmx1000 which has no echo effect, a crown xls402 power amp and wharfedale evpx15 loaded with jbl drivers an xovers

the sound is good loud and clear with a deep rich bass

the problem is I do karaoke and need an echo to make the singers sound a little better

can anyone recommend an echo effect I could add into one of the mic channels on the mixer

Depends how much you want to spend but for fifty or sixty quid, you should be able to pick up a used Alesis Midiverb effects unit which will give you all the echo/reverb/delay fx you'll ever need - and more.
